Latest Patents

One of her latest patents focuses on fluorine-labeled compounds. This invention provides methods for introducing a fluorine atom onto a polypeptide. The methods include providing a linker with a thiol-reactive terminus and an aldehyde-reactive terminus, reacting the thiol-reactive terminus with a polypeptide, and subsequently reacting the aldehyde-reactive terminus with a fluorine-substituted aldehyde. Another notable patent involves cellulose substrates, compositions, and methods for the storage and analysis of biological materials. This invention outlines a method for storing genetic material or analytes from a biological sample using a cellulose substrate with specific structural units.
